Biography
Foreword to Dr. Gursev Sandlas' academics!
- Dr Gursev Sandlas completed his MBBS from Grant Medical College and Sir JJ Group of Hospitals.
- He underwent Post Graduate and Post Doctoral training at LTM Medical College at Sion, Mumbai.
- He further trained in Reconstructive Pediatric Urology at Nationwide Children's Hospital, Columbua, Ohio, USA and in Robotic Pediatric Surgery at Comer Childrens's Hospital, Chicago, USA.
- At present he heads the Only Comprehensive Robotic Pediatric Surgery program in India

Why do we need a pediatric urologist?
Children cannot share what is bothering them or answer medical questions. A pediatric urologist focuses on the special needs of children. They use equipment designed for children and know how to treat and examine children in a manner that makes them relaxed and cooperative.
